As The Devil Wears Prada franchise teases the possibility of a third film, the cast has revealed two crucial conditions for their return. In an exclusive interview with People, Meryl Streep, Anne Hathaway, and Emily Blunt expressed their interest in reuniting for The Devil Wears Prada 3, but only if the script and key members of the cast are in place.
The trio agreed that the film would have to offer a compelling script to draw them back to their iconic roles. Streep, 76, responded quickly, stating, “The script,” while Blunt, 43, added, “A good script. It’s all about the script.” Hathaway, 43, echoed the sentiment, emphasizing that "everybody has to say yes."
Blunt, who plays Emily Charlton in the franchise, further stated that the return of "the core four" — Streep, Hathaway, Blunt, and Stanley Tucci, who played Nigel in the original film — is essential for the sequel. Streep humorously added, “They have to be alive,” referring to the need for all the key actors to return.
The actors also reflected on their return to the franchise after nearly two decades. Hathaway revealed that revisiting her role as Andy Sachs made her reflect on the significant personal growth she had experienced since the first film. “I was just a 22-year-old mess,” she shared, adding that she was now in a much more stable phase of her life, having found love and started a family.
Streep, on the other hand, found the experience of revisiting Miranda Priestly “kind of easy” and enjoyed discovering the character again. Blunt, who portrays the eccentric Emily, expressed how deeply connected actors become to their roles and how much fun it was to revisit hers.
The sequel, The Devil Wears Prada 2, is already in theaters and reunites the original lead cast along with new additions such as Kenneth Branagh, Simone Ashley, Justin Theroux, and Lucy Liu. Fans of the first film will also see familiar faces like Tracie Thoms and Tibor Feldman in the sequel.
